2-Indanone Consensus Reports

Stability: Stable under normal temperatures and pressures.
Storage:Store in a tightly closed container. Store in a cool, dry, well-ventilated area away from incompatible substances.
Handling:Wash thoroughly after handling. Remove contaminated clothing and wash before reuse. Use with adequate ventilation. Avoid contact with eyes, skin, and clothing. Keep container tightly closed. Avoid ingestion and inhalation
First Aid Measures:
Ingestion: If victim is conscious and alert, give 2-4 cupfuls of milk or water. Never give anything by mouth to an unconscious person. Get medical aid immediately.
Inhalation: Remove from exposure to fresh air immediately. If not breathing, give artificial respiration. If breathing is difficult, give oxygen. Get medical aid.
Skin: Get medical aid. Flush skin with plenty of soap and water for at least 15 minutes while removing contaminated clothing and shoes. Wash clothing before reuse.
Eyes: Flush eyes with plenty of water for at least 15 minutes, occasionally lifting the upper and lower eyelids. Get medical aid immediately.

2-Indanone Specification

The 2-Indanone, with the CAS registry number 615-13-4,is also known as Indan-2-one. It belongs to the product categories of Indane/Indanone and Derivatives;Indanone & Indene. This chemical's molecular formula is C9H8O and molecular weight is 132.16. Its EINECS number is 210-410-3.What's more,Its systematic name is Indan-2-one.It is a Wet crystalline aggregates.The 2-Indanone is irritating to eyes, respiratory system and skin.When you use it ,wear suitable protective clothing ,avoid contact with skin and eyes,and do not breathe dust.In case of contact with eyes, rinse immediately with plenty of water and seek medical advice

Physical properties about 2-Indanone are:
(1)ACD/LogP:  2.4; (2)# of Rule of 5 Violations:  0; (3)ACD/LogD (pH 5.5):  2.40; (4)ACD/LogD (pH 7.4):  2.40; (5)ACD/BCF (pH 5.5):  39.28; (6)ACD/BCF (pH 7.4):  39.28; (7)ACD/KOC (pH 5.5):  481.64; (8)ACD/KOC (pH 7.4):  481.64; (9)#H bond acceptors:  1; (10)#H bond donors:  0; (11)#Freely Rotating Bonds:  0; (12)Index of Refraction:  1.585; (13)Molar Refractivity:  38.558 cm3; (14)Molar Volume:  115.022 cm3; (15)Surface Tension:  44.867000579834 dyne/cm; (16)Density:  1.149 g/cm3; (17)Flash Point:  100 °C; (18)Enthalpy of Vaporization:  48.613 kJ/mol; (19)Boiling Point:  248.918 °C at 760 mmHg; (20)Vapour Pressure:  0.0240000002086163 mmHg at 25°C.

You can still convert the following datas into molecular structure:
(1)SMILES:O=C2Cc1ccccc1C2;
(2)Std. InChI:InChI=1S/C9H8O/c10-9-5-7-3-1-2-4-8(7)6-9/h1-4H,5-6H2;
(3)Std. InChIKey:UMJJFEIKYGFCAT-UHFFFAOYSA-N.
